Wait for Full Restoration

23And not only the creation, but we ourselves, who have the firstfruits of the Spirit, groan inwardly as we wait eagerly for adoptions as sons, the redemption of our bodies.” – Romans 8:23 (ESV)

In my family we have 3 automobiles and the newest of them is a 2005 model with 220,000 miles. Our other two are a 2004 and 1997 with 185,000 and 97,000 miles respectively. Now it may seem as though we are in need of new vehicles, we look at them simply as a means of transportation and work for us.

Thinking of my physical body here in this world. It is not in the best of shape. I am round in the middle, soft in most places and could stand to lighten up a bit as well. Not exactly the picture of a well oiled machine. But, this body is simply a means of getting along and works for me and the plan God has for my life.

I will be getting a new body once I am in glory with God. I will be restored to outward beauty to go along with the inward beauty I have received from Christ with my salvation. I will be restored to the classic state God sees in me.

Here in this world, I wait for my restoration. I know that the process is slow and steady. I know that I will not be completed here. I know that the final work on me will be completed in heaven. I must proceed with what I have and “wait eagerly” for my full restoration.

Are you aware of what you have today? Are you looking to get brand new now? Will you wait eagerly for your full restoration to the classic God will restore you to?
